What Are the Benefits of Green Tea Capsules?
Green tea capsules are high in antioxidant containing polyphenols, the most powerful being epigallocatechin (EGCG). Polyphenols are plant compounds that have numerous benefits for human health and nutrition.-
History
-
Green tea has been cultivated and consumed in China since antiquity to boost immune function, promote cardiovascular health and treat arthritis.
Potential
-
Polyphenols may inhibit cancer cell proliferation, decrease the risk of developing blood clots (thrombosis), increase metabolism, lower cholesterol and blood glucose, maintain healthy cell function and kill some types of unhealthy bacteria.

Expert Insight
-
The National Cancer Institute published a study claiming that regular green tea consumption can reduce your chances of developing esophageal cancer by up to 60 percent.
Benefits
-
Green tea capsules have all the benefits of green tea without having to take the time to brew numerous cups daily. The cost of green tea capsules is relatively low; websites list a 60-capsule bottle for under $10.
